We're gonna be able to have multiple CAMPs :o :toot: .

Bethesda wrote:It can be tough to decide between building a brand-new home or sticking with your current C.A.M.P. creation, because you can only have one at a time. Going forward, you won’t have to choose whether to open a Wasteland B&B, fortify a Free States outpost, or run your own Red Rocket Station—Instead, C.A.M.P. Slots will help you do it all. Your characters will be able to build multiple different C.A.M.P.s, each with its own location, build budget, custom name, and even a unique map icon. While you will only be able to have one active C.A.M.P. at a time, you can easily switch among them using a new C.A.M.P. Builds widget or your C.A.M.P. icons on the map.

Further, managing the items you want to sell has never been easier, because your Vending Machines will now feature a large pool of item slots that are shared for every instance, across all your C.A.M.P.s. Display Cases will be separate per C.A.M.P., allowing you to showcase different items at each one. Along with these changes, we’re also working to enable Displays in Shelters, so that you have even more opportunities to show off your loot. We’re still implementing some of this Vending and Display functionality, so these changes may arrive after the PTS has already begun.


This is a terrific move; it's always a shame to tear down a CAMP that you spent a long time building 'cos you would like to move elsewhere.

Oh! And perk card loadouts are gonna be introduced, too :-). All this and more is gonna be available on the PC PTS (Public Test Server) next Friday, 5 February. Provided it all goes smoothly, the updates should then be introduced into the game on all formats soon after. Click here to see the full details on all of the planned updates.

Victor Mildew wrote:I may be understanding you wrong, but are you starting from scratch when you move? I know when I move mine, the main structure and contents are one lump, then and individual items like a fire have to be placed separately.

Yeah, each time I move camp I start building from scratch. You can sometimes move your old camp to your chosen new location, but it depends on how rough the ground is; until recently you could hardly ever re-place your camp again, but it has improved slightly now.

I like to start fresh as you can try to take advantage of features of the new location. The floor blocks are crucial; I try to get them lined up exactly (for example, parallel to a mineral extractor machine in my current location). It takes time to start new each time but I enjoy it :-).

There are a couple of known building bugs at the moment; you can't place steel poles onto bases (but there is a workaround through fixing them to a roof piece instead) and the defences (fence items) can only be affixed to base floors, not upper floors i.e. no balconys at the moment (you can work around this by attaching the fencing to a roof panel and then removing the roof and replacing it with a floor; but this doesn't work for the smaller floor pieces). Both are due to be fixed in the next couple of updates.
